Transaction 750461b6cca926d853cdb0d65916f3b60f07ef2f4bbefea8840fca154e9154e4

2 Input
2 Outputs
  • 750461b6cca926d853cdb0d65916f3b60f07ef2f4bbefea8840fca154e9154e4:0
  • value  11114600
    address  14fcxQ64cLot9kEoLRVZ7jQBpxmMFi5AtL
  • 750461b6cca926d853cdb0d65916f3b60f07ef2f4bbefea8840fca154e9154e4:1
  • value  587739
    address  15TrHScb5e6xwanmYYesNX44CiDiiAhkcs